Preparation Steps for Creamy Ranch Chicken

Step 1: Slice and Prepare Chicken

Grab your chicken breasts and carefully slice each one horizontally to create two thinner cutlets. This technique ensures even cooking and helps the chicken absorb more delicious flavors.

Step 2: Season the Chicken

Mix together a flavor-packed blend of:
  • Garlic powder
  • Mixed herbs
  • Salt
  • Black pepper

Massage this seasoning mix all over both sides of each chicken cutlet, making sure every inch gets coated with tasty goodness.

Step 3: Sizzle the Chicken

Heat a skillet with a combination of olive oil and butter over medium-high heat.

Carefully place the seasoned chicken cutlets into the hot pan. Cook each side for 3-4 minutes until they turn a beautiful golden brown and are completely cooked through.

Transfer the chicken to a plate and keep it warm.

Step 4: Create the Ranch Base

In the same skillet, lower the heat and add an extra pat of butter.

Toss in minced garlic and quickly sauté until it becomes wonderfully fragrant. Sprinkle in flour and stir for about 30 seconds to create a smooth base.

Step 5: Build the Creamy Sauce

Slowly pour chicken stock into the skillet, whisking continuously to prevent any lumps from forming. Let the sauce simmer and start to thicken slightly.

Step 6: Finish the Ranch Sauce

Turn the heat down low and stir in:
  • Sour cream
  • Ranch seasoning

Whisk until the sauce becomes smooth and irresistibly creamy. Remove the skillet from the heat.

Step 7: Combine and Serve

Gently place the seared chicken back into the skillet, spooning the luscious ranch sauce over each cutlet. Make sure every piece is generously coated with the creamy goodness.

Serve immediately while warm and enjoy your ranch chicken masterpiece!

Expert Tips on Creamy Ranch Chicken

  • Slice chicken breasts carefully to maintain even thickness, preventing uneven cooking and dry edges.
  • Pat chicken dry before seasoning to help spices adhere better and achieve a perfect golden-brown sear.
  • Use a meat thermometer to ensure chicken reaches 165°F internally, guaranteeing safe and juicy results.
  • Let chicken rest briefly after cooking to help juices redistribute, keeping meat tender and flavorful.
  • Adjust ranch seasoning intensity by gradually adding more or less to suit personal taste preferences.

Flavor Variations of Creamy Ranch Chicken

  • Spicy Ranch Chicken: Replace ranch seasoning with cayenne pepper and hot sauce for a fiery kick.
  • Greek-Style Chicken: Swap ranch seasoning for dried oregano, add crumbled feta cheese, and use Greek yogurt instead of sour cream.
  • Low-Carb Ranch Chicken: Substitute flour with almond flour or cornstarch, use coconut cream in place of sour cream for a keto-friendly version.
  • Herb-Infused Chicken: Incorporate fresh chopped rosemary, thyme, and parsley into the seasoning mix for an aromatic herb profile.

Storage Suggestions for Creamy Ranch Chicken

  • Transfer leftovers to an airtight container and store in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. Ensure the chicken is completely cooled before sealing to prevent moisture buildup.
  • Wrap individual chicken cutlets with ranch sauce in plastic wrap, then place in a freezer-safe bag. Freeze for up to 2 months, removing as much air as possible to prevent freezer burn.
  • Place chicken on a microwave-safe plate, cover with a damp paper towel to retain moisture. Heat on medium power in 30-second intervals, stirring sauce between intervals until heated through.

FAQs

  • How do I ensure the chicken cutlets are cooked perfectly?

To ensure perfectly cooked chicken cutlets, slice them evenly, use a meat thermometer to check internal temperature reaches 165°F, and sear them for 3-4 minutes on each side until golden brown.

  • Can I make this recipe gluten-free?

Yes, substitute regular flour with cornstarch or gluten-free flour blend when creating the sauce. This will maintain the sauce’s creamy texture while making the dish gluten-free.

  • What type of herbs work best in this recipe?

Mixed dried herbs like thyme, oregano, and basil complement the ranch flavor perfectly. Fresh herbs can also be used, with parsley or chives adding a bright, fresh note to the dish.

Instructions

  1. Slice each chicken breast horizontally into two thin, even cutlets to guarantee uniform cooking and tenderness.
  2. Mix garlic powder, mixed herbs, salt, and pepper in a small bowl. Thoroughly massage this seasoning blend onto both surfaces of the chicken cutlets, ensuring complete flavor absorption.
  3. Warm olive oil and butter in a skillet over medium-high heat until shimmering. Carefully place seasoned cutlets into the hot pan, searing for 3-4 minutes per side until achieving a golden-brown exterior and reaching internal temperature of 165°F.
  4. Remove chicken from skillet and tent with foil to retain warmth. In the same pan, reduce heat to medium and add another butter tablespoon.
  5. Quickly sauté minced garlic for 30 seconds until aromatic. Sprinkle flour into the pan, stirring continuously for an additional 30 seconds to create a roux.
  6. Slowly stream chicken stock into the skillet, whisking vigorously to prevent lumps. Allow sauce to simmer and gradually thicken.
  7. Reduce heat and incorporate sour cream and ranch seasoning, whisking until sauce transforms into a smooth, creamy consistency.
  8. Gently return seared chicken cutlets to the skillet, coating each piece thoroughly with the rich ranch sauce. Serve immediately while warm, ensuring generous sauce coverage.

Notes

  • Slice chicken breasts horizontally to create uniform thickness, guaranteeing even cooking and preventing dry edges.
  • Use a sharp knife and steady hand when cutting chicken to maintain consistent cutlet sizes for professional-looking results.
  • Pat chicken dry with paper towels before seasoning to help spices adhere better and promote perfect golden-brown searing.
  • Adjust heat carefully when sautéing to prevent burning garlic and creating bitter flavors in the ranch sauce.
  • Whisk sauce ingredients gradually and continuously to prevent lumps and achieve silky smooth consistency.
  • For lighter version, substitute sour cream with Greek yogurt and use less butter during cooking.
  • Gluten-sensitive individuals can replace flour with cornstarch or gluten-free flour blend for sauce thickening.
  • Enhance ranch flavor by adding fresh chopped herbs like chives or dill to the final sauce.
